Formal and Informal Language

  • 2.  No living language is simply one set of words which can be used the same way in all situations.  It means that there are infinite variety of different ways to arrange its elements. What this means is that there are many ways to say the same thing, depending on where you are, who you are talking to, and how you feel.
  • 3.  Language is a set of symbols being used mainly for communication.  The symbols may be spoken or written.  Language is the key aspect of human intelligence.
  • 4. Spoken Language: Speech is a natural, convenient, rapid and the oldest means of communication.
  • 5. Written Language: A written language is one that uses the equivalent of typed alphabetic characters in which words are clearly separated by spaces and punctuation marks.
  • 7. We use formal language in situations that are serious or that involve people we don’t know well.
  • 8. The balloon was inflated for the experiment.
  • 9. Informal language is more commonly used in situations that are more relaxed and involve people we know well.
  • 10. The balloon was blown up for the experiment.
  • 11. Formal language  is less personal than informal language.  used when writing for professional or academic purposes like university assignments.  does not use colloquialisms(informal), contractions or first person pronouns such as ‘I’ or ‘We’.
  • 12. Informal language  is more casual and spontaneous.  used when communicating with friends or family either in writing or in conversation.  used when writing personal emails, text messages and in some business correspondence.  is more personal than formal language.
  • 13.  Formal and informal language affects your every day.  As a society, the type of language that is used, whether it is formal or informal, is directly dependant on the culture and customs that are the most prevalent.  In the age of T.V. and the internet, the need to communicate to the audience at its level has degraded the level of formality needed in order to speak effectively.
